Achieving the Unhas Amendoada Shape

Step-by-Step Shaping Process

To create the almond shape, a careful shaping process is necessary. Follow these steps:

1. Start with a Square Base: After filing your nails to a square shape, they’ll provide a sturdy base for the almond style.
2. Tapering the Sides: Gently file down both sides of the nail, creating a tapering effect.
3. Round the Tip: After achieving the desired sides, round off the tip of the nail to form the characteristic point of the almond shape.
4. Buffing: Once shaped, buff the surface lightly to eliminate any imperfections and create a smooth canvas for the gel.

Tip: Using Dual Forms for Consistency

For those who prefer not to freehand the shaping process, consider using dual forms. These pre-shaped molds can provide a safe and uniform structure for your nails, guaranteeing identical looks for each nail.

Application of Gel for Unhas Amendoada

Base Coat: The Foundation of a Great Manicure

Applying a high-quality base coat is essential for the longevity of your gel nails. The base coat not only prevents staining but also provides a better adherence environment for the gel polishes. Here’s how to apply it properly:

1. Clean and Dehydrate: Clean your nails and use isopropyl alcohol to dehydrate the surface.
2. Apply Base Coat: Paint a thin layer of base coat, ensuring coverage without touching the cuticles. Cure under UV/LED lamp as per the manufacturer’s instructions.

The Color Layers: Perfecting Your Design

Choosing the right colors is vital for achieving stunning looks. Here are some techniques:

1. Two-Tone Look: To take your unhas amendoada to the next level, consider a two-tone color scheme. This involves applying two different shades on each hand or utilizing a gradient effect that blends hues together.

2. Nail Art: Nail art can elevate any design. You can use stamping kits, striping brushes, or stickers to add unique details.

3. Negative Space: Combining the negative space trend with unhas amendoada can create an artful design, playing with shapes while allowing your natural nail to peek through.

Top Coat: Sealing the Deal

Once your color layers are set and cured, applying a top coat is crucial. This layer not only adds shine but also protects your design from chipping and daily wear.

1. Thin Application: Apply a thin layer over the entire surface, ensuring that it covers the tips of the nails as well.
2. Final Cure: Cure under the UV/LED lamp, and remember to wipe away the sticky residue with a lint-free cloth soaked in isopropyl alcohol.

Nail Care Post-Application

Regular Maintenance Matters

Just like your hair or skin, your nails need routine attention to keep them looking fabulous:

Hydration: Continue regular moisturizing of nails and cuticles to prevent dryness.
Routine Filing: Keep your nails manicured by filing them to prevent breaks.
Dissolving Gel: When it’s time to remove the gel, don’t peel it off. Instead, use acetone to soak your nails gently, ensuring the natural nail health remains intact.

Repairing Damaged Nails

If you notice any splits or tears, act immediately to prevent further damage. Use a base coat or nail strengthener to provide a temporary protective layer until repair is possible.
